Summary

This video is the first session of a teacher training course for psychology students in their eighth semester. The instructor, Pablo Adrián Rivera Juvenal, welcomes students and congratulates them on reaching this point. He introduces himself, mentioning his background in philosophy and law, and his current studies in education. He presents a supplementary website called ‘Oasis’ where students can find study guides, exercises, and articles. He also explains the YouTube channel where session recordings will be posted. The instructor discusses scheduling, emphasizing evening times and avoiding Mondays due to holidays. He introduces the concept of ‘horizontalidad’ in education, where teacher and students are equals, and references Paulo Freire’s idea that people educate each other. He stresses that teaching is more of an art than a science, as each teacher develops their own style. The session covers course logistics, resources, and foundational pedagogical concepts.
